Renombrar paquete a @nucleoriofrio/webmcp y fix crash de stdin
- Renombrar de @jason.today/webmcp a @nucleoriofrio/webmcp en package.json, config.js, websocket-server.js, build/index.js y README - Fix crash de stdin cuando no hay TTY: agregar check process.stdin.isTTY y try/catch en setRawMode - Bump version a 0.2.0
This commit is contained in:
@@ -1,6 +1,6 @@
|
||||
# WebMCP - Fork Nucleo Rio Frio
|
||||
|
||||
> **IMPORTANTE: Este es un fork modificado de [@jason.today/webmcp](https://github.com/jasonjmcghee/webmcp) v0.1.13.**
|
||||
> **IMPORTANTE: Este es un fork modificado de [@jason.today/webmcp](https://github.com/jasonjmcghee/webmcp) v0.1.13, renombrado a `@nucleoriofrio/webmcp`.**
|
||||
> La documentación original, diagramas de arquitectura y explicaciones detalladas del protocolo se encuentran en el repositorio upstream.
|
||||
> Las APIs base deberían ser idénticas — si encontrás discrepancias entre este fork y la documentación original, reportalo porque se supone que deben ser compatibles salvo por los parches descritos abajo.
|
||||
|
||||
@@ -59,7 +59,7 @@ npm install git+https://gitea.nucleoriofrio.com/nucleo000/webmcp.git
|
||||
### En tu HTML
|
||||
|
||||
```html
|
||||
<script src="node_modules/@jason.today/webmcp/src/webmcp.js"></script>
|
||||
<script src="node_modules/@nucleoriofrio/webmcp/src/webmcp.js"></script>
|
||||
<script>
|
||||
const webmcp = new WebMCP({
|
||||
color: '#00d4ff',
|
||||
@@ -88,7 +88,7 @@ En `.claude/settings.json` o settings del proyecto:
|
||||
"mcpServers": {
|
||||
"webmcp": {
|
||||
"command": "node",
|
||||
"args": ["node_modules/@jason.today/webmcp/src/websocket-server.js", "--mcp"]
|
||||
"args": ["node_modules/@nucleoriofrio/webmcp/src/websocket-server.js", "--mcp"]
|
||||
}
|
||||
}
|
||||
}
|
||||
@@ -118,6 +118,6 @@ El código JavaScript recibe `args` como parámetro y debe retornar un string. S
|
||||
## Referencia upstream
|
||||
|
||||
- **Repositorio original:** https://github.com/jasonjmcghee/webmcp
|
||||
- **npm:** https://www.npmjs.com/package/@jason.today/webmcp
|
||||
- **npm (original):** https://www.npmjs.com/package/@jason.today/webmcp
|
||||
- **Versión base:** 0.1.13
|
||||
- **Licencia:** MIT (sin cambios)
|
||||
|
||||
Reference in New Issue
Block a user